Quincy Issa, originally named Iiko Isami, is a nineteen-year-old commander in the anime Brain Powerd. She is the elder sister of the protagonist Yuu Isami and leads the Grand Cher squadron of the organization known as the Reclaimers, piloting the red Grand Cher called the Quincy Grand. She is a small, slender young woman with short brown hair and blue eyes.

Growing up as the daughter of the Isami family, whose parents were researchers devoted to the mysterious structure Orphan, she was made to serve as a test pilot for Grand Cher units from childhood. She silently endured the pain and pressure of this role for the sake of her family, an experience that gradually warped her personality. Influenced by fellow pilot Jonathan Glenn, she came to reject her birth name and her family identity. Taking the name Quincy Issa, a name Jonathan said was fit for a queen, she insisted that even her parents use it, and she sought to distance herself from the family in order to establish herself independently.

Quincy is brash, hot-tempered, and combative, with a fierce will to stand her ground. As the leader of the Grand Cher squadron she is cold and ruthless, readily disregarding human emotion in pursuit of her mission. As an antibody, a person whose mind has been shaped and hardened by the will of Orphan, she became a fervent devotee of Orphan's cause, devoting her entire youth to protecting it. Underneath this severity, she is described as having a strongly maternal quality, directing deep affection toward her Grand Cher and toward Orphan itself. She also shows a sisterly care for Yuu, her only emotional anchor, though it is complicated by her commitment to her beliefs.

Her central motivation is the defense of Orphan and the success of the Reclaimers, a cause she embraces all the more firmly as a way of defining herself apart from her family. This places her in direct opposition to the crew of Novis Noah, against whom she leads her squadron in battle. Her feelings toward Yuu are a mix of love and hatred: she resents him for being favored by the Antibodies of Orphan and for abandoning their parents and betraying the Reclaimers, yet she internally wishes he would return to Orphan.

Her key relationships are defined by these tensions. With Yuu, she wavers between resentment and genuine sisterly concern. Her bond with Jonathan Glenn is competitive, as the two vie for control of the Reclaimers even as Jonathan acts as the one who gave her her chosen name. With her parents, she is openly antagonistic, having rejected the identity they gave her. Her encounter with Hime Utsumiya becomes pivotal, as Hime attempts to rescue her during the later stages of the conflict.

Quincy's development comes when her hardened convictions are shaken by Yuu's insistence that Orphan should be released from its guilt. Confused by this, she becomes the point at which her own Grand Cher rebels against her state of mind. Orphan itself then favors her as the Girl of Orphan, a chosen embodiment of Orphan's will. In the end, she is rescued by Yuu, who helps her understand what Orphan truly wanted to do, allowing her to move past the hatred that had defined her.

Her notable abilities center on her piloting and command. Trained in Grand Cher operation from childhood, she is a skilled and aggressive combatant in the red Quincy Grand, a machine that suffers heavy damage over the course of many battles and is eventually captured by Novis Noah. As a squadron commander, she is forceful and dominant, able to lead the Reclaimers' pilots through sustained combat operations.
